First things first, let's talk about grip. To throw a frisbee in a specific direction, you need to have a solid grip on the disc. Place your thumb on top of the frisbee, with your fingers spread out underneath for stability. This grip will give you better control over the direction and release of the frisbee.

Next, it's all about your body positioning. Stand with your feet shoulder-width apart, facing your target. Keep your non-throwing arm extended out in front of you for balance. As you prepare to throw, shift your weight onto your back foot, and then transfer it forward as you release the frisbee. This weight transfer will help generate power and accuracy in your throw.

Now, let's talk about the actual throwing motion. Start by bringing the frisbee back towards your dominant shoulder, keeping it parallel to the ground. As you begin to throw, rotate your hips and shoulders towards your target, while extending your arm forward. This motion will help generate the power and momentum needed for a strong and accurate throw.

As you release the frisbee, make sure to follow through with your throwing arm. This means extending your arm fully and pointing it towards your target. The follow-through is crucial for accuracy and control, so don't neglect it!

To throw the frisbee in a specific direction, you can also adjust the angle of release. Tilting the frisbee slightly up or down can help you control the trajectory. For example, if you want to throw the frisbee higher, tilt the leading edge of the disc up. If you want to throw it lower, tilt it down. Experiment with different angles to find what works best for you.
